According to the public record, 67, St. Marys Road, Smethwick is a period freehold house with 785 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 162 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 67, St. Marys Road, Smethwick is £208,879 and the estimated rental value is £1,090 per month.
St. Marys Road, Smethwick, B67 is located in the borough of Sandwell within the B67 postal district.
67, St. Marys Road, Smethwick has 21 entries in the Land Registry , most recently in December 2012 and a single entry in the EPC database dated March 2022.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 67, St. Marys Road, Smethwick is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£219,323 and a rental value of £1,144 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£194,257 and a rental value of £1,013 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 67 St. Marys Road Smethwick has increased by an estimated £4,492 (2.2%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£31 per month (2.8%), giving an expected gross yield of 6.3%.

67, St. Marys Road, Smethwick has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 22 Mar 2022.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 67, St. Marys Road, Smethwick was last sold on 20th December 2012 for £126,500 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 2 sales since 1995.
Since December 2012, the market for similar properties has risen 48.6%
According to the Land Registry and our network of Estate Agents, there have been 3 sales of properties similar to 67, St. Marys Road, Smethwick within a radius of 380 metres over the last 2 years.
The most recent example is 74, St. Marys Road, Smethwick, B67 5DQ, a freehold house which sold for £190,000 on the 30th January 2026.
